Charles-Town, (South Carolina), October 20.  [Description of
public protests of the Stamp Act, including hanging of
effigies of Stamp Agents]
The bells of St. Michael's church rang muffled all day; and
during the procession, there was a most solemn knell for the
burial of a coffin, on which was inscribed "American
Liberty."
